Tunisia Makes its Debut at CES 2025 with a Dedicated Pavilion

For the first time, Tunisia is participating in the largest international exhibition dedicated to modern technologies and innovation, CES 2025, taking place in Las Vegas, USA, from January 7 to 10, 2025.

This unprecedented initiative is the result of a strategic partnership between CONECT - Confederation of Tunisian Citizen Enterprises, the US Embassy in Tunisia, the PROMISE program, the Tunisian-American Association of Young Skills, and in close collaboration with the Tunisian Embassy in Washington, with the support of the "Startups and Innovative SMEs" project, funded by the World Bank and implemented by the Caisse des Dépôts et Consignations in partnership with Smart Capital.

This marks a new step in the development of the Tunisian entrepreneurial ecosystem.

A conference on the advantages of investing in Tunisia, particularly in the technology sector, is scheduled for Tuesday, January 7, at the Tunisian pavilion. The "Startups and Innovative SMEs" project will also be presented, under the presidency of the Tunisian Ambassador to Washington, with the participation of the General Director of the Caisse des Dépôts et Consignations and the General Director of Smart Capital, who will be attending specifically to support this event and meet with the Tunisian delegation as well as foreign investors and experts.

Tunisian exports to the United States mainly include food products, such as dates and packaged olive oil, as well as energy, technology, renewable energy, and automotive parts. The United States is also the top destination for Tunisian handicraft products.

The "Startups and Innovative SMEs" project, funded by the World Bank, aims to encourage the creation and development of startups and innovative small and medium-sized enterprises, while stimulating economic prospects and job opportunities for young Tunisians.
